rep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
configure: use relative paths for in-tree build
2013-01-30
grisc
h
ka
configu
r
e: use relative paths for in-tree bu
i
ld
commit
|
commitdiff
|
tree
2013-01-24
grisc
h
ka
win32: _mingw
.
h: do not undef NULL
commit
|
commitdiff
|
tree
2013-01-14
g
r
ischka
Revert "Optimi
z
e vs
w
ap()"
commit
|
commitdiff
|
tree
2013-01-14
gr
i
sc
h
ka
R
e
vert mi
s
take i
n
"win32: malloc
.
h
:
fix win32
.
.
.
_S
T
ATI
C
_AS
.
.
.
commit
|
commitdiff
|
tree
2013-01-06
gr
i
schka
Fix "Optimize cstr_re
s
et() to
o
nly
reset strin
g
to
.
.
.
commit
|
commitdiff
|
tree
2013-01-06
gri
s
c
h
ka
tccpp: alternative fix for
#
i
nc
l
ude_next infinite
loop bug
commit
|
commitdiff
|
tree
2012-12-20
gris
c
hka
Makefile: revamp
"
t
ar
"
t
arget
commit
|
commitdiff
|
tree
2012-12-20
g
r
ischk
a
win32: build-tcc
.
bat:
get
r
id
of hardcoded
VER
S
I
ON
.
.
.
commit
|
commitdiff
|
tree
2012-09-01
g
r
ischka
tccrun:
a
nother incompatib
l
e
cha
n
ge to the tcc_r
e
locate API
commit
|
commitdiff
|
tree
2012-06-12
grischka
Revert "Make ex1
.
c and ex4
.
c
be executa
b
le on an
y
systems"
commit
|
commitdiff
|
tree
2012-06-12
g
r
i
s
c
h
ka
t
c
c
.
c
:
f
ix argv index for p
a
rse_ar
g
s
commit
|
commitdiff
|
tree
2012-04-18
grischk
a
libtcc: tcc
_
get_
s
y
m
bol uses the TCCSta
t
e
parameter
commit
|
commitdiff
|
tree
2012-04-18
g
r
ischka
supp
o
r
t "x8
6
_64
-
linux-gnu"
subdirs with l
i
b & incl
u
d
e
commit
|
commitdiff
|
tree
2012-04-18
grischk
a
tcc_realloc: auto "memory
f
ull" error
commit
|
commitdiff
|
tree
2012-04-18
grischka
tcc
.
h
:
u
nify m
u
l
tiple
#i
f
de
f
CONFIG_T
C
C_BA
C
KTRACE
commit
|
commitdiff
|
tree
2012-04-18
grischka
cleanup s
o
me partially
broken patches
commit
|
commitdiff
|
tree
2012-04-18
g
rischka
w
in32: tcc
.
exe uses libtcc
.
dll
commit
|
commitdiff
|
tree
2012-04-18
grischka
t
cc
.
c: fix
p
revi
o
us co
m
mit "Use CString to concat linker
.
.
.
commit
|
commitdiff
|
tree
2012-03-05
g
r
ischka
x86_64: fix loading
o
f LL
O
CAL
f
loats
commit
|
commitdiff
|
tree
2012-03-05
grischka
tcc
.
h:
define TCC_I
S
_NATIVE
commit
|
commitdiff
|
tree
2011-08-11
grischka
rename error/warning -> tcc_(error/
w
arning)
commit
|
commitdiff
|
tree
2011-08-11
grischka
libtcc:
m
inor adju
s
tments
commit
|
commitdiff
|
tree
2011-08-06
g
r
ischka
li
b
t
c
c:
s
upport more t
h
an one crtprefix
commit
|
commitdiff
|
tree
2011-08-06
gris
c
hka
libtcc: cleanup the 'gen_ma
k
edeps' s
t
uff
commit
|
commitdiff
|
tree
2011-08-06
gri
s
chk
a
tcc: fix
-
m3
2
/64 & si
m
pl
i
f
y
commit
|
commitdiff
|
tree
2011-08-06
gr
i
schka
tc
c
t
e
s
t: switch weak_toolate pro
t
o w
i
th
i
mpl
commit
|
commitdiff
|
tree
2011-08-06
grischka
x86-64: f
i
x flags
a
n
d zero-pad lon
g
dou
b
les
commit
|
commitdiff
|
tree
2011-08-06
grischk
a
configure:
a
d
d switches to
set search paths
commit
|
commitdiff
|
tree
2011-07-31
grischka
Accept c
o
lon separated paths with -L and -I
commit
|
commitdiff
|
tree
2011-07-16
grischk
a
Revert "better constant
h
andl
i
ng
f
o
r expr
_
c
ond
"
commit
|
commitdiff
|
tree
2011-07-14
grischka
e
l
f
.
h:
de
f
ine S
H
F_MER
G
E etc
.
commit
|
commitdiff
|
tree
2011-07-14
grisc
h
k
a
win64: va_arg with structure
s
commit
|
commitdiff
|
tree
2011-07-14
grischka
tcc
p
e: cleanup ELFW()
m
a
cros etc
.
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ccrun:
win32:
impro
v
e exception
han
d
l
e
r
commit
|
commitdiff
|
tree
2011-07-14
g
r
ischka
t
c
crun: win32:
im
p
r
ove rt_get_caller_pc
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ccrun: rt_pr
i
ntline:
fix no-stabs case
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ccrun: improve rt_
p
r
i
ntli
n
e o
u
tput form
a
t
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ccrun: win64: add un
w
ind
function
t
able for dynam
i
c
.
.
.
commit
|
commitdiff
|
tree
2011-07-14
grischka
tccgen: res
e
t a
l
igned attribute for next t
y
pe
commit
|
commitdiff
|
tree
2011-07-14
grischk
a
make:
create n
a
tive
t
cc from separate obj
e
cts
commit
|
commitdiff
|
tree
2011-07-11
gri
s
c
hka
win
3
2
:
a
d
d -
W
l
,--st
a
c
k
=xx
x
switch
commit
|
commitdiff
|
tree
2011-07-11
g
rischka
win32/include: ena
b
le _
t
imezone etc
v
ar
i
ables
.
commit
|
commitdiff
|
tree
2011-05-17
gris
c
h
k
a
tcc-doc: remove obsolete '-o option must
a
lso be given'
commit
|
commitdiff
|
tree
2011-03-06
gri
s
chka
tccpp: fix
pro
b
lem i
n
p
r
e
process_sk
i
p wi
t
h empty
#
commit
|
commitdiff
|
tree
2011-02-13
gris
c
hka
tccpe:
support leading underscore for symb
o
ls
commit
|
commitdiff
|
tree
2011-02-04
gr
i
schk
a
fix crash with get_tok_str() in skip()
commit
|
commitdiff
|
tree
2010-12-04
gri
s
chka
tiny
_
libma
k
er
:
strip le
a
ding director
y
to avoid
b
uffer
.
.
.
commit
|
commitdiff
|
tree
2010-12-04
grisch
k
a
tcc
e
lf
/
tcccoff: fix some type conv
e
r
sion warnings
commit
|
commitdiff
|
tree
2010-12-04
grischka
make: new lib/Makefi
l
e f
o
r libtc
c
1
.
a
on more
p
l
atfo
r
ms
commit
|
commitdiff
|
tree
2010-11-27
g
ri
s
c
hka
tccpe: typed
e
f
u
ns
i
gned int DWORD
for cros
s
com
p
ile
r
s
.
commit
|
commitdiff
|
tree
2010-11-26
grisch
k
a
build: remove #include "config
.
h
"
from tar
g
et dependent
.
.
.
commit
|
commitdiff
|
tree
2010-11-26
grisch
k
a
libt
c
c:
fix s->include_s
t
ack_ptr us
e
d
uninitializ
e
d
.
.
.
commit
|
commitdiff
|
tree
2010-11-25
gr
i
s
c
hka
tccpp: fix token pasting ##
commit
|
commitdiff
|
tree
2010-11-25
g
r
ischka
l
i
btcc: new function tcc_open_bf t
o
create BufferedFile
commit
|
commitdiff
|
tree
2010-10-19
gris
c
hka
w
i
n32:
r
egister SEH in
startup code (
i
386 only)
commit
|
commitdiff
|
tree
2010-09-08
grischka
tccmain: simplify option help
commit
|
commitdiff
|
tree
2010-08-21
grischka
Revert
"
imple
m
e
n
ted C99 for loop with varia
b
l
e declar
a
tion"
commit
|
commitdiff
|
tree
2010-06-30
grischka
Avoid crash
w
i
th "Avoid a crash w
i
th weak sy
m
b
ols for
.
.
.
commit
|
commitdiff
|
tree
2010-06-21
grischka
t
c
cgen
:
Revert yuanbin's
rece
n
t patch
e
s
commit
|
commitdiff
|
tree
2010-06-15
grisch
k
a
Rev
e
r
t
"
C
o
m
plain for
s
tati
c
fct decl
a
red
w
/o file scope
"
commit
|
commitdiff
|
tree
2010-06-15
grisc
h
ka
Fi
x
"Fix
b
ashims
i
n
conf
i
g
u
re
.
.
.
" fo
r
MSYS
commit
|
commitdiff
|
tree
2010-06-15
g
risch
k
a
F
i
x last commit
s
: remove CRL
F
, chmod
644 t
c
cgen
.
c
commit
|
commitdiff
|
tree
2010-04-13
grisc
h
ka
tccelf: fix war
n
ing
commit
|
commitdiff
|
tree
2010-04-12
gr
i
schka
win32:
s
ys/timeb
.
h use _ftime in
s
t
e
a
d of _
f
time
3
2
commit
|
commitdiff
|
tree
2010-01-26
grischka
win32
:
ad
j
ust for ming
w
32 wina
p
i p
a
ck
a
g
es
commit
|
commitdiff
|
tree
2010-01-14
grischka
t
c
cpp: signal mi
s
sing #endif error
commit
|
commitdiff
|
tree
2010-01-14
grischka
tccpp: convert TOK_G
E
T macro
i
nto function
commit
|
commitdiff
|
tree
2010-01-14
g
rischka
tcc
p
p: warn about
#def
i
n
e redefinit
i
on
commit
|
commitdiff
|
tree
2010-01-14
grischka
win64
:
defined size_t a
n
d
ptrdiff_t to un
s
ig
n
ed long
.
.
.
commit
|
commitdiff
|
tree
2010-01-14
grischka
w
i
n
32:
cleanup include
commit
|
commitdiff
|
tree
2010-01-14
grischka
x86
-
64: us
e
uplong
for symbol values
commit
|
commitdiff
|
tree
2010-01-14
gr
i
schk
a
t
c
cpe: impr
o
ve dllimp
o
rt/expo
r
t and use
f
or
tcc_add_sy
m
bol
commit
|
commitdiff
|
tree
2010-01-14
grischka
win32: r
e
adm
e
: ad
d
libtcc_test
exampl
e
commit
|
commitdiff
|
tree
2009-12-20
grischka
u
p
d
a
te Makefiles
commit
|
commitdiff
|
tree
2009-12-20
grischka
bu
i
ld from multi
p
l
e o
b
je
c
ts: fix
other targ
e
ts
commit
|
commitdiff
|
tree
2009-12-20
gri
s
chka
x
86-64: fix g
t
st,
b
a
ck
to only 5
r
egs f
o
r n
o
w
commit
|
commitdiff
|
tree
2009-12-20
gri
s
chka
x86-64: u
s
e r
8
/
r9
as generic integer
registers
commit
|
commitdiff
|
tree
2009-12-20
grischka
x86-64: use r8,r9 a
s
load/store registers
commit
|
commitdiff
|
tree
2009-12-20
g
r
ischka
win32: a
d
d size_t
t
o _mingw
.
h
commit
|
commitdiff
|
tree
2009-12-20
grischka
use vpus
h
v
in
s
ome place
s
commit
|
commitdiff
|
tree
2009-12-20
grisc
h
ka
win64: add tiny unwin
d
data
for
s
e
t
jmp/longjmp
commit
|
commitdiff
|
tree
2009-12-20
grischka
al
l
o
w tcc be build fro
m
separate objects
commit
|
commitdiff
|
tree
2009-12-19
grisc
h
ka
win32: enabl
e
bo
u
nds checker & exception handler
commit
|
commitdiff
|
tree
2009-12-19
grischka
tcc_re
l
ocate
:
r
evert to 0
.
9
.
24 behavior
commit
|
commitdiff
|
tree
2009-12-19
gri
s
chka
tccrun: new file
commit
|
commitdiff
|
tree
2009-12-19
grisc
h
ka
fix u
n
initiali
z
e
d
warni
n
gs
w
ith 'type
.
r
ef'
commit
|
commitdiff
|
tree
2009-12-19
grischka
tc
c
pe: w
i
th
-
l try also with "l
i
b" pr
e
fix
commit
|
commitdiff
|
tree
2009-12-19
grischka
t
c
cpe: improve dlli
m
p
ort
commit
|
commitdiff
|
tree
2009-12-19
grischka
inte
g
rate x86_64
-
a
s
m
.
c into i386-asm
.
c
commit
|
commitdiff
|
tree
2009-12-19
gri
s
c
hka
tcc: add
"-Wl,-rp
a
th=path" option (library search p
a
th
)
commit
|
commitdiff
|
tree
2009-12-19
g
r
is
c
h
ka
x
86-64:
fix udiv,
add cqto instru
c
tion
commit
|
commitdiff
|
tree
2009-12-19
g
r
i
s
c
h
ka
tccpe: all
o
w li
n
ka
g
e to
ext
e
rn s
y
mbo
l
s from asm
commit
|
commitdiff
|
tree
2009-12-19
g
r
i
s
chka
tc
c
asm: m
a
ke
V
T
_
VOID
s
ymbols ST_N
O
TYPE, e
l
f-wise
commit
|
commitdiff
|
tree
2009-12-19
g
r
i
schka
x86-
6
4: in gv(): ignor
e
second register
commit
|
commitdiff
|
tree
2009-12-19
grischka
win64:
adjust
f
or two args with setjmp(buf,c
t
x)
commit
|
commitdiff
|
tree
2009-12-19
Christian
Jullien
x86-64: Fix Wrong comp
a
risonbetweenpoin
t
erandlongcste
commit
|
commitdiff
|
tree
2009-12-06
grischka
i3
8
6-as
m
:
fix i
m
ul
commit
|
commitdiff
|
tree
2009-12-06
grisch
k
a
tccgen
:
propagate alignment from typede
f
commit
|
commitdiff
|
tree
2009-12-01
bobbl
avoi
d
needless regi
s
ter save when storing st
r
uctures
commit
|
commitdiff
|
tree
2009-12-01
Bernhard Reutner
.
.
.
d
ocument -print
-
search-dirs
commit
|
commitdiff
|
tree
next